A new coffee shop named Desert Kid Coffee is set to open in Palm Desert, California, by the end of this year. Located at 44850 San Pablo Avenue, the establishment will be co-founded by Katie Reed, a native of the Coachella Valley. According to Orr Builders, construction has recently commenced on the site, with an anticipated completion date in mid-November.

Construction Progress and Location Details
The property, originally built in 1955, spans 5,402 square feet and is currently leased through Wilson Meade Commercial Real Estate. As part of its development, a construction fence has been erected around the site this week, marking the beginning of the transformation into a vibrant coffee shop. The location benefits from having 10 dedicated parking spots and is strategically positioned within the retail corridor of San Pablo Avenue, an area that recently received an $8.5 million investment aimed at enhancing local businesses.
With construction expected to wrap up by mid-November, the team is projecting a grand opening date in December 2023. This timeline reflects the commitment to delivering a quality experience to future customers in Palm Desert.
